Elmer Joseph (“E.J.”) Generotti
Elmer Joseph (“E.J.”) Generotti, (admitted 1977) passed away peacefully on February 18, 2021. A native of Jessup, Pennsylvania (born August 17, 1952), E.J. was a 44-year member of the Florida Bar, and a member of the very first graduating class of Nova Southeastern University/Shepard Broad College of Law, graduating in its inaugural class in 1977. Mr. Generotti began his career at the Broward County State’s Attorney’s Office and served on the Board of Directors of Legal Aid Services of Broward. He was an honorable, active, and highly respected member of the Broward County legal community by both members of the bench and bar. He held himself to the highest ethical standards in every aspect of his career as an attorney and was a tireless advocate for his many clients over four decades. His word was his bond. Mr. Generotti was a partner at the Law Firm of Frank, Weinberg & Black, P.L., where he was considered an indispensable member of the litigation department. He devoted the last 22 years of his practice at the Firm and is remembered as a highly skilled trial attorney and advocate; and a trusted advisor to both his clients and colleagues alike. Mr. Generotti was viewed by many as a member of their extended family because he treated everyone as if they were a valued member of his family and genuinely cared about people. He will be missed by all that had the privilege of knowing him.
However, as much as Mr. Generotti enjoyed the practice of his profession and his professional colleagues, he enjoyed his family far more. A devoted husband to his wife of 41 years, Debra, and father to his daughter, Stephanie and son, Jason, Mr. Generotti cherished his family and the memories they shared together. E.J. particularly enjoyed summers with his family and friends at his favorite place – his family’s second home at Moosic Lake, Pennsylvania.
